But the above commenter is saying it
doesn't translate 'literally' to that, but rather, that is the equivalent meaning.
The 'literal translation' would be translating word-by-word, which by definition isn't going to work for idioms:
> idiom
>
> A group of words established by usage
> as having a meaning not deducible from
> those of the individual words
Oxford Dictionary